What is the price?

The cost to replace the key in your car depends on the year, model and model of your vehicle. Some newer vehicles have transponder chips inside the keys that need to be linked to the vehicle by a dealership or auto locksmith before they work, and this can add to the overall price of replacement. The type of key can be a factor in the cost. Some mechanical keys that are older can be replaced inexpensively and more advanced smart keys may need to be reprogrammed, or completely rebuilt.

The kind of key is the first factor to consider when determining the price. Mechanical keys are easy and straightforward, and can be replaced by a local locksmith for under $50. However, if you own more sophisticated keys that uses a transponder or a key fob to unlock and start your vehicle, the price will be significantly higher. The transponder and the key fob must be programmed to connect, which requires special equipment that can only be found at a dealer or auto locksmith.

Key fobs can serve as remotes that use electronic technology to open doors and start cars. Some come with a display that shows you the condition of your vehicle. Certain keys can cost up to $500.

What is the Process?

The particulars of the key car replacement process depend on your specific type of car. If you have mechanical keys that are inserted into the lock, and then turned, the process for a locksmith or key cutter is fairly simple. Modern keys have more security and convenience features, which can make them more difficult to replace.

Certain key fobs are different from traditional keys made of metal that they require a different key to open the doors and start up the engine. They are usually more difficult to duplicate, and they may need to be programmed by an expert, which could increase the cost.

If you have an older model with an old-fashioned metal key, the process is fairly straightforward. A key cutter or locksmith can duplicate the original with no difficulty. If your car is equipped with transponders in the key, you'll have to bring it to the dealer for a replacement.

The dealership will need to have your vehicle identification number (VIN) as well as a copy of your driver's licence in order to purchase the new key for your vehicle. Once they receive the key they will need to program it in order that it is compatible with your vehicle. The keyless entry remote may also require reprogramming, which could be a lengthy process based on the complexity of your vehicle's anti-theft system.
